Extent of Therapy



Emergency situation dental care concentrates on dealing with urgent dental issues such as serious toothaches or injuries that call for immediate attention. When you experience unexpected and extreme pain, swelling, bleeding, or injury to your teeth or periodontals, seeking instant care from an emergency dental professional is essential. These specialized dental specialists are outfitted to take care of serious cases that can not wait for a regular consultation.

Whether it's a knocked-out tooth, a broken tooth, or intolerable discomfort, emergency dentistry gives punctual relief and necessary therapy to ease your discomfort.

In emergency dental care, the key goal is to stabilize your problem, handle your discomfort, and stop additional damage to your dental wellness. From performing emergency situation extractions to offering short-term fillings or repair services, the emphasis is on dealing with the immediate problem available. Once the urgent trouble is fixed, you may be referred back to your regular dental professional for any type of follow-up care or added therapy needed to recover your dental wellness.

Response Time



For urgent oral concerns, timely reaction time plays a vital duty in minimizing pain and protecting against further problems. When encountering an oral emergency situation, such as serious toothaches, knocked-out teeth, or sudden swelling, time is important. Seeking prompt care from an emergency dentist can make a considerable distinction in the result of your scenario. Delays in treatment can't just extend your pain but also enhance the risk of infection or irreversible damage to your teeth and gums.

On the other hand, regular dentistry consultations are typically set up ahead of time for routine examinations, cleanings, or non-urgent procedures. While these visits are important for preserving dental health and wellness, they're typically not meant to resolve immediate issues that require instant focus. Regular dentistry concentrates on preventative care and lasting therapy planning rather than on-the-spot interventions for severe problems.



For that reason, when confronted with an abrupt dental issue that can't wait, it's important to focus on fast action and look for aid from an emergency situation dentist to attend to the concern immediately and properly.
